Sec. 12-169. Payment of taxes due on Saturday, Sunday or legal holiday. When
the final day for payment of any tax occurs on Saturday, Sunday or a legal holiday,
payment may be made without interest or penalty on the following business day.


      (1949 Rev., S. 1850; February, 1965, P.A. 26.)


      History: 1965 act included payment on business days following Saturdays which are final days for payment.


      See Sec. 12-39a re payment date for state taxes when last date is Saturday, Sunday or holiday.
